What is silicone?
Back
Silicone is a synthetic polymer made up of silicon, oxygen, carbon, and hydrogen. It is known for its flexibility, durability, and resistance to heat and cold.

What is an alloy?
Back
An alloy is a mixture of two or more elements, where at least one is a metal. Alloys are created to enhance certain properties, such as strength or corrosion resistance.

What are the properties of elastomers?
Back
Elastomers are polymers that exhibit elastic properties, meaning they can stretch and return to their original shape. They are often used in applications requiring flexibility.

What is the significance of using polymers in robotics?
Back
Polymers are significant in robotics due to their lightweight, flexibility, and ability to be molded into complex shapes, which can enhance robot design and functionality.
